Surgeon - Pediatric examines, diagnoses, and surgically treats children from the newborn stage through late adolescence. Treats a wide variety of problems children may have, which may include appendicitis, hernias, cancer, or a serious congenital anomaly. Being a Surgeon - Pediatric reviews patient history and confirms need for surgery. Determines which instruments and method of surgery will be most successful in achieving desired outcome. Additionally, Surgeon - Pediatric may provide medical personnel with direction concerning patient care. May provide in-service training as needed to address new technology in health care treatment. Provides charting in compliance with all laws and regulations. Requires a MD degree from an accredited school. Typically reports to the chief of surgery. Requires a license to practice.     Outstanding Opportunity for a Pediatric and Congenital Heart Surgeon at Nicklaus Children’s Hospital in Miami

    The Heart Institute at Nicklaus Children’s Hospital is seeking a pediatric and congenital heart surgeon to join the team in Miami, Florida. The ideal candidate will be board certified in Thoracic and Congenital Cardiac Surgery. A track record of technical excellence and strong interpersonal skills are desired. Candidates with several years of independent operative experience are preferred in order to divide cases between two surgeons. Annual surgical volume is approximately 350 cases. The Heart Institute at Nicklaus is the largest pediatric cardiac center in South Florida.

    Nicklaus Children’s Hospital is an affiliate of the Florida International University Herbert Wertheim College of Medicine. Our state-of-the-art Advanced Care Pavilion houses a 34-bed cardiac in-patient unit with an adjustable acuity model that allows all rooms to accommodate critically ill patients with heart disease.

Miami, officially the City of Miami, is the cultural, economic and financial center of South Florida. Miami is the seat of Miami-Dade County, the most populous county in Florida. The city covers an area of about 56.6 square miles (147 km2), between the Everglades to the west and Biscayne Bay on the east; with a 2017 estimated population of 463,347, Miami is the sixth most densely populated major city in the United States.
